#d433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d433ce is composed of 83.1% red, 20%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.9% magenta, 2.8%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 302.2 degrees, a saturation of 65.2% and a lightness of 51.6%. #d433ce color hex could be obtained by blending #ff66ff with #a9009d.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#d433ce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d433ce has RGB values of R:212, G:51,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.76, Y:0.03,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13906894.

Shades and Tints of #d433ce
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070106 is the darkest color, while #fdf5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d433ce
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#887f88 is the less saturated color, while #fa0df1 is the most saturated one.
